logo

Output 89af55394f3d5679a373e13c474ad1029f76b5162cd1c882848b97c96b7c9d26:0

value
24970890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84c44fc11dbf503fe0dea77b19d8a7efdfa570d OP_EQUAL
address
3MQhFGtzMSMyMqLXqYVeHUNVAhqihnshjy
transaction
89af55394f3d5679a373e13c474ad1029f76b5162cd1c882848b97c96b7c9d26